The Poison Called Love is a heart-pounding thriller that weaves together love, betrayal, and the unrelenting pursuit of truth. Dr. Joel Zoe, a renowned surgeon, is thrust into a nightmarish conspiracy after saving a poisoned boy linked to a powerful family. Taken hostage by ruthless criminals, Zoe must navigate treacherous alliances, unravel the mystery of the boy's poisoning, and protect his own family from deadly threats.

As the line between victim and villain blurs, Zoe uncovers shocking secrets buried within a fractured family. The evidence he desperately seeks lies hidden in an unexpected place, but exposing it could cost him everything. Against the backdrop of a society riddled with greed and corruption, Zoe must confront not only his enemies but also his own past, as love, both a weapon and a curse emerges as the ultimate poison.

Will Zoe unearth the truth before it's too late, or will the poison of love claim its final victim? The Poison Called Love is a haunting and emotional journey that explores the sacrifices we make for love and the lengths we go to uncover justice.

Radi Ibrahim Nuhu is a writer known for his compelling short stories that delve into themes of resilience, self-discovery, and the deep connections between people and the world around them. His short story Kilaza and the Sound Machine explores the journey of a young boy, Kilaza, who creates an invention that bridges the gap between him and the animal world, leading to a powerful transformation in his life and his relationship with his father. Radi's writing captures the human spirit through simple yet profound narratives, drawing readers into thought-provoking and emotionally resonant tales.
